Fertility Friday: Plant Proteins


Animal proteins have long been favored over their plant protein counterparts.  Animal proteins have more satiety, due to their higher fat content and then are often complete proteins in themselves and do not need to be complimented. This was an excellent way to maintain a good metabolism and appropriate amount of fat and calories when food was less abundant. Today, with food so abundant it is easy to consume the right compliment of plant proteins to get a complete protein.  Eating animal proteins can increase the amount of insulin like growth factor 1, contributing to infertility and poor ovulation.  So substitute a few animal based proteins a week for eggs, legumes, or soy.
